How to Use:
Simply pluck a fresh leaf and chew it for a surprisingly sweet treat, toss a few leaves into your hot or iced tea, or muddle them in a cocktail. You can also dry the leaves and crush them into a powder to use in baking or for a longer-lasting sweetener.
Potential Health & Wellness Benefits of Stevia
The Stevia plant is more than just a sweetener. For centuries, it has been used in traditional medicine. Modern research has begun to investigate some of its remarkable properties. The primary active compounds responsible for its sweetness and potential benefits are called steviol glycosides (e.g., Stevioside and Rebaudioside A).
Here are some of the widely recognized potential benefits:
Excellent Sugar Substitute for Diabetics: Stevia has a Glycemic Index of 0. It does not raise blood glucose or insulin levels, making it a safe and effective sugar alternative for individuals managing Type 1 or Type 2 diabetes.
Supports Weight Management: With zero calories and zero carbohydrates (0ย kcal), Stevia can help satisfy sweet cravings without contributing to daily caloric intake, making it a valuable tool for weight loss or maintenance plans.
May Help Modulate Blood Pressure: Some clinical studies have suggested that certain compounds in Stevia, particularly stevioside, may help relax blood vessels. This vasodilation effect can contribute to lowering high blood pressure (hypertension) over time with regular consumption.
Promotes Dental Health: Unlike sugar, Stevia is non-cariogenic. This means it does not contribute to the formation of dental cavities. Oral bacteria cannot metabolize it to create the acids that erode tooth enamel.
Rich in Antioxidants: The leaves of the Stevia plant contain a variety of antioxidant compounds, including flavonoids, triterpenes, and phenols. These antioxidants help protect the body's cells from damage caused by free radicals and oxidative stress.
Potential Anti-Inflammatory Properties: Some research indicates that steviol glycosides may exhibit anti-inflammatory effects, which could be beneficial for overall health.
